- Title
Lupus erythematosus profundus.
- Authors
Rao, T. Narayana; Ahmed, Kamal; Venkatachalam, K.
- Abstract
The article presents a study of a 39-year-old female reporting the development of a single, asymptomatic, erythematous plaque in the upper part of left arm. There is no reported history of trauma, or injection. Examination revealed a large erythematous plaque with well-defined margins, sharply demarcated over the lateral aspect of the left arm the diagnosis of lupus erythematosus profundus (LEP).
